Severe Thunderstorm Warning
National Weather Service San Angelo TX
1015 PM CDT Sun Jun 8 2025

The National Weather Service in San Angelo has issued a

* Severe Thunderstorm Warning for...
  South central Haskell County in west central Texas...
  Jones County in west central Texas...
  Fisher County in west central Texas...

* Until 1115 PM CDT.

* At 1014 PM CDT, a severe thunderstorm was located over Mccaulley,
  moving east at 40 mph.

  HAZARD...Golf ball size hail and 60 mph wind gusts.

  SOURCE...Radar indicated.

  IMPACT...People and animals outdoors will be injured. Expect hail 
           damage to roofs, siding, windows, and vehicles. Expect 
           wind damage to roofs, siding, and trees.

* This severe thunderstorm will be near...
  Hamlin, Neinda, and Mccaulley around 1020 PM CDT.
  Anson around 1040 PM CDT.
  Hawley around 1055 PM CDT.

Other locations impacted by this severe thunderstorm include Hodges,
Funston, The Intersection Of Us-
180 And Ranch Road 126, Hitson, Tuxedo, Lake Fort Phantom Hill,
Truby, and The Intersection Of Us-180 And Farm Road 600.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a
building.
